## Runbook: sort stability in Fernwright reports

Welcome aboard. Quick context: the Fernwright report builder uses an unstable sort by default, so rows with equal keys can shuffle between runs. Customers notice, then file tickets. The fix is the stable-sort flag plus a deterministic tiebreaker column, both set at the service level rather than per report. Don't flip these in the UI — it won't persist past a restart. Set them in the service config instead, which currently reads as follows.

config for kagup-hahig:
druwyn:
  pin: 2801
  metrics_host: metrics.druwyn.zemvarlabs.internal
  tenant: sorius
  seal: seal_798a43d7

## Contrast Audit — Plugin Authors

All Lanternkit plugins must pass the Hueline contrast audit before listing. Run the audit locally via the CLI. Minimum ratio: 4.5:1 for text, 3:1 for large type and UI controls. Failures block publication; no exceptions. Re-submit after fixes. The audit report lists each failing token. For audit disputes or tooling bugs, write to the address below.

pager mailbox: silael.sorwyn.tamius@zemvarsys.corp

Changed defaults in Splitfork, our assignment service. Bucketing now uses sticky hashing per account instead of per session, and the holdout slice grew from 2% to 5%. Callers relying on session-level reassignment must opt in explicitly. Review the diff against the new baseline; the updated default configuration is listed below.

config for tagep-kajof:
[casir]
port = 6379
region = south-1
host = casir.paliqdyn.example
team = tamax
timeout_ms = 250
retries = 2

**Vendor note: Inkmill markdown pipeline**

Rendering for Parchway docs is outsourced to Inkmill under an annual contract, renewing each March. They handle sanitization and PDF export; we own the upload queue. SLA: 4-hour response on rendering failures. Escalate only after two failed retries. Their support desk is reachable at the address below.

billing contact of hahaf-baguf = zorael.tammir.jorius@sivrelhq.internal

Cleaning crews contracted to Wrenfold Court must sign in at the service entrance and wear their issued lanyards at all times while on site. Access is limited to the hours of 19:00 to 23:00 on weekdays, and supervisors must confirm crew numbers with the duty manager before work begins. The service entrance door is secured after 18:30, so crews should use the code below.

turnstile pass: bdg-FVNQRS-72965873